Has now been transformed into The Calm Zone.

The Calm Zone has been designed using universal design and autism-friendly principles and is currently being featured as an example of autism-friendly design in the prestigious 2021 Venice Architecture Biennale.

A dedicated space of respite and calm for students, the Calm Zone is laid out across two levels with each aspect of the space considered to maximise autism-friendliness and designed to global design guidelines for built environments to be used by individuals with autism.
